The Oxfordshire Home Front, 1914-1918, by Stephen Barker.
The impact of the war in the towns and countryside that will focus upon fundraising and charitable events, munitions production, recruitment, the effects upon women and children, the fear of invasion, the influx of Belgian refugees and many other themes. The talk is fully illustrated and uses testimony from those who were there.
Stephen is an independent Heritage Advisor who works with several heritage organisations including the History Faculty, University of Oxford and the Soldiers of Oxfordshire Museum. Stephen specialises in military history, particularly the First World War and British Civil Wars and is a Trustee of the Bucks Military Museum Trust.
